The documentation XML-RPC server in Python through 2.7.16, 3.x through 3.6.9, and 3.7.x through 3.7.4 has XSS via the server_title field. This occurs in Lib/DocXMLRPCServer.py in Python 2.x, and in Lib/xmlrpc/server.py in Python 3.x. If set_server_title is called with untrusted input, arbitrary JavaScript can be delivered to clients that visit the http URL for this server.

In Pannellum from 2.5.0 through 2.5.4 URLs were not sanitized for data URIs (or vbscript:), allowing for potential XSS attacks. Such an attack would require a user to click on a hot spot to execute and would require an attacker-provided configuration. The most plausible potential attack would be if pannellum.htm was hosted on a domain that shared cookies with the targeted site's user authentication; an <iframe> could then be embedded on the attacker's site using pannellum.htm from the targeted site, which would allow the attacker to potentially access information from the targeted site as the authenticated user (or worse if the targeted site did not have adequate CSRF protections) if the user clicked on a hot spot in the attacker's embedded panorama viewer. This was patched in version 2.5.5.

When pasting a <style> tag from the clipboard into a rich text editor, the CSS sanitizer does not escape < and > characters. Because the resulting string is pasted directly into the text node of the element this does not result in a direct injection into the webpage; however, if a webpage subsequently copies the node's innerHTML, assigning it to another innerHTML, this would result in an XSS vulnerability. Two WYSIWYG editors were identified with this behavior, more may exist. This vulnerability affects Firefox ESR < 68.4 and Firefox < 72.
